Merge pull request #667 from victorsl/BUG-7408
BUG 7408 "Fire Fox English/Sumatoria" SOLVED
This commit is contained in:
@@ -3409,7 +3409,7 @@ function putFieldNumericValue(elem, num, mask, decimalSeparator)
|
||||
|
||||
var strAux = maskNumber.split("").reverse().join("");
|
||||
cont = 0;
|
||||
pos = 0;
|
||||
pos = -1;
|
||||
|
||||
for (i = 0; i <= strAux.length - 1; i++) {
|
||||
if (strAux.charAt(i) == "#") {
|
||||
@@ -3422,26 +3422,35 @@ function putFieldNumericValue(elem, num, mask, decimalSeparator)
|
||||
}
|
||||
}
|
||||
|
||||
var mask2 = strAux.substring(0, pos + 1);
|
||||
mask2 = mask2.split("").reverse().join("");
|
||||
var mask2 = "";
|
||||
|
||||
if (pos != -1) {
|
||||
mask2 = strAux.substring(0, pos + 1);
|
||||
mask2 = mask2.split("").reverse().join("");
|
||||
} else {
|
||||
mask1 = maskNumber;
|
||||
}
|
||||
|
||||
maskNumber = mask1 + mask2;
|
||||
}
|
||||
|
||||
var newNumber = putStringMask(n.split("").reverse().join(""), maskNumber.split("").reverse().join(""));
|
||||
var newDecimal = putStringMask(d, maskDecimal);
|
||||
|
||||
newNumber = newNumber.split("").reverse().join("");
|
||||
var newNumber = putStringMask(n, maskNumber, "reverse");
|
||||
var newDecimal = putStringMask(d, maskDecimal, "forward");
|
||||
|
||||
elem.value = newNumber + decimalSeparator + newDecimal;
|
||||
}
|
||||
|
||||
function putStringMask(str, mask)
|
||||
function putStringMask(str, mask, dir)
|
||||
{
|
||||
var newStr = "";
|
||||
var i1 = 0;
|
||||
var i2 = 0;
|
||||
|
||||
if (dir == "reverse") {
|
||||
str = str.split("").reverse().join("");
|
||||
mask = mask.split("").reverse().join("");
|
||||
}
|
||||
|
||||
for (i1 = 0; i1 <= mask.length - 1; i1++) {
|
||||
switch (mask.charAt(i1)) {
|
||||
case "#":
|
||||
@@ -3460,6 +3469,10 @@ function putStringMask(str, mask)
|
||||
}
|
||||
}
|
||||
|
||||
if (dir == "reverse") {
|
||||
newStr = newStr.split("").reverse().join("");
|
||||
}
|
||||
|
||||
return newStr;
|
||||
}
|
||||
|
||||
|
||||
@@ -5,15 +5,13 @@
|
||||
<link rel="shortcut icon" href="/images/favicon.ico" type="image/x-icon"/>
|
||||
{$_header}
|
||||
{literal}
|
||||
<!--[if IE]>
|
||||
<style>
|
||||
table.x-pm-headerbar td, table th {
|
||||
padding-top: 5px;
|
||||
padding-bottom: 5px;
|
||||
padding-right: 0px;
|
||||
<!--[if lt IE 8]>
|
||||
<style type="text/css">
|
||||
.x-pm-headerbar-data {
|
||||
padding-top: 8px;
|
||||
}
|
||||
</style>
|
||||
<![endif]-->
|
||||
<![endif]-->
|
||||
{/literal}
|
||||
</head>
|
||||
<body>
|
||||
@@ -21,18 +19,18 @@
|
||||
<div id="panel-header" />
|
||||
|
||||
<div id="header-content" style="display:none">
|
||||
<table class="x-pm-headerbar">
|
||||
<table class="x-pm-headerbar">
|
||||
<tr>
|
||||
<td width="50%" valign="middle">
|
||||
<img src="{$logo_company}" height="40"/>
|
||||
</td>
|
||||
|
||||
<td align="right" valign="top">
|
||||
<td class="x-pm-headerbar-data" align="right" valign="top">
|
||||
<table width="100%" height="25" border="0" cellspacing="0" cellpadding="0" class="headerRightSection">
|
||||
<tr valign="middle">
|
||||
<td align="right">
|
||||
{if $licenseNotification != ''}
|
||||
<span class="x-pm-license-notification">
|
||||
<span class="x-pm-license-notification">
|
||||
<img src="/images/alert_icon.gif" width="10px" headerRightSection="10px"/> {$licenseNotification}
|
||||
</span>
|
||||
{/if}
|
||||
@@ -40,15 +38,15 @@
|
||||
<td height="12" valign="middle" align="right" valign="top">
|
||||
<a href="#" id="options-tool" class="options-tool">
|
||||
{$userfullname}
|
||||
<span>
|
||||
<img src="/images/classic/roll.static.gif" width="10px" headerRightSection="10px"/>
|
||||
<span>
|
||||
<img src="/images/classic/roll.static.gif" width="10px" headerRightSection="10px"/>
|
||||
</span>
|
||||
<br />
|
||||
<span style="font-size:9px">{$rolename}</span>
|
||||
</a>
|
||||
</td>
|
||||
<td width="40" align="right">
|
||||
<span id="user-avatar">
|
||||
<span id="user-avatar">
|
||||
<img src="{$user_avatar}" width="25" height="25"/>
|
||||
</span>
|
||||
</td>
|
||||
|
||||
Reference in New Issue
Block a user